INTERESTED IN APPLYING?
Below is the information you need to know:

Identification and Income:
-All applicants must have current photo identification and a valid Social Security number.
-The applicant's monthly income must be at least 2.5 times the rent and come from a verifiable source.
-The landlord only considers applicants with verifiable income.

Background Checks:
-All applicants and residents aged 18 and older must undergo a background check.
-The applicant's background must exhibit a pattern of responsibility.
-There is a $50 application fee per person.
-Applicants must not have any evictions, unpaid judgments from previous landlords, or other civil suits.
-Applicants must receive positive references from all landlords and references for the last five years.

Leasing Details:
-Be open and honest about your past before applying, along with a non-refundable application fee.
-After conditional approval, the landlord requires a one-month security deposit payment to remove the property from syndicated sites and payment of the first month's rent before signing the lease.
-Residents pay for water, trash, gas (if applicable), and electricity. If desired, they are responsible for phone, internet, TV, etc.
-Residents must have renters' insurance for the entire duration of the lease.
-Smoking (including tobacco, marijuana, vaping, or any other forms of smoking) is prohibited anywhere on the property, including the house, porches, and grounds. All applicants MUST be non-smokers.
-The property is unfurnished.
Residents cannot use the house for business purposes or sublease it.
-The landlord signs yearly leases.


Pets and Animals

-There is a $300.00 non-refundable animal fee per animal.
-Monthly animal fees are $50.00 per animal, if applicable.
-Visit our Animal Policy page for more information.

If the applicant fails to meet any of the above requirements, compensating factors such as an additional security deposit or co-signer (guarantor) may be required for qualification at the landlord's discretion.

If there are multiple applicants, the landlord will grant the tenancy on a first-come, first-served basis to the most qualified applicant.
